What is a transponder key?

Transponder keys are reprogramme car key key that has an security measure against theft in it. This is done by integrating a radio frequency identification microchip in the plastic head portion of the key. This chip is used to relay a signal to the vehicle's immobilizer during ignition's start-up procedure. This stops hot-wiring the car, making it extremely difficult to take your vehicle.

It isn't the case that transponder keys are a guarantee. Even though they add a layer of security but criminals still have the capability to use their expertise to break into vehicles. It simply means that it takes much more time and effort to accomplish this, which is why this security feature is a huge advantage for anyone who cares about the safety of their vehicle.

Transponder keys are simple to use. The microchip inside the plastic head of the key is programmed with a unique digital serial number that correlates to the immobilizer system of your vehicle. When you insert the key into the ignition, the immobilizer system will detect the serial number and verify it. If it matches the number, the engine will start and if it doesn't it does, the car won't start.

There are many different kinds of transponder chips that can be programmed. The type of chip that your vehicle uses will determine the kind of key that you have. Search engines and professional locksmiths can assist you in finding the appropriate transponder to match your vehicle.

In general transponder keys tend to be more expensive to replace than non-transponder keys as they have the added expense of a microchip. The dealership that sells your vehicle is the most expensive alternative to replace your key since they have the most overhead. However, you can also visit locksmiths to get a new key.

Another important thing to remember is that you can only program the transponder key only if it has not been cut before. You can attempt to do it yourself by purchasing a transponder from one of the many stores that provide these services, but you will require a special device to complete the task.

What is the procedure to program a transponder?

A car key that has chip inside is a type of transponder key. They are designed to guard against auto theft by ensuring that only the correct key is able to start the vehicle. Locksmiths can create a new key for you if you've lost yours or the chip is damaged in any way. In the majority of instances, programming a chip-key is a simple and simple process. Some cars require specialized equipment for programming the key.

To begin, you must first identify the type of key that you have. To ensure you have the correct key blank, it is essential to know your vehicle's make, model and year. Some keys come with a transponder chip inside the key head, while others don't. If your key is chipped the bow cover will be more hefty. It is also possible to tell if your key has chip by looking at your ignition. If it has a push-to start button instead of a key hole, it is probably an ignition with chip.

The next step is to choose which programming method will be employed. Certain transponder keys can be programmed using onboard diagnostics while others require a specialized key programming device. The key programming device has to be compatible with the circuit board key that is being used, and must also work at the same frequency as the vehicle's onboard computer.

It may be tempting to save money by programming a transponder yourself however, this could be risky. If you do not follow the proper steps you could damage the information stored on your chip, making it impossible for you to start your car. For this reason, it is always best to work with an authorized professional with access to the right tools and know-how to program your key correctly. It is a good idea, while you have the keys, to make extras to be able to replace them quickly and easily if you lose one.

How do I program a transponder-key?

You have to program the chip in the head of the car key programmed key if your vehicle is controlled by a transponder. This process can be tricky particularly if your keys are lost or damaged. It is possible to start the car without a transponder, but it's not recommended. In these instances you should contact a professional locksmith or a car dealership to solve the problem.

To program a transponder keys, you'll need the right tools and know the proper procedure for your vehicle. Transponder keys usually come with an antenna ring on their head that transmits radio frequency energy to a chip within. The antenna rings receives an identification code from the chip. Once the transmission has been received the ignition system will detect that the key was put in and will turn on.

If you have the right equipment and know the process for your vehicle, you are able to do it at home. The majority of manufacturers have their own methods of programming, which may require specific tools. It is important to know that programming car key requires a long battery life. If your battery dies, you will need to start the process over again.

This is why most people prefer having professionals do it for them. Transponder keys that are properly programmed can save you money and time.
